Daily Mouthwash May Cut COVID-19 Transmission Risk

Within the combat towards the novel Coronavirus, a workforce of German scientists has claimed that Sars-Cov-2 viruses may be “inactivated” utilizing commercially obtainable mouthwashes. In line with the research, printed within the Journal of Infectious Ailments, excessive viral masses may be detected within the oral cavity and throat of some Covid-19 sufferers. Using mouthwashes which might be efficient towards Sars-Cov-2 might, thus, assist to cut back the viral load and presumably the danger of Coronavirus transmission over a brief time period, the researchers stated. “Gargling with mouthwash can not inhibit the manufacturing of viruses within the cells, however might scale back the viral load within the brief time period the place the best potential for an infection comes from, particularly within the oral cavity and throat,” stated research researcher Toni Meister from Ruhr-Universitat Bochum in Germany.

For the findings, the analysis workforce examined eight forms of mouthwashes with completely different components which might be obtainable in pharmacies or drugstores in Germany.

They combined every mouthwash with virus particles and an interfering substance, which was meant to recreate the impact of saliva within the mouth.

The combination was then shaken for 30 seconds to simulate the impact of gargling.

The researchers then used Vero E6 cells, that are significantly receptive to Sars-Cov-2, to find out the virus titer.

So as to assess the efficacy of the mouthwashes, the workforce additionally handled the virus suspensions with cell tradition medium as a substitute of the mouthwash earlier than including them to the cell tradition.

The entire examined preparations decreased the preliminary virus titer, the research stated.

The findings confirmed that three mouthwashes decreased it to such an extent that no virus might be detected after an publicity time of 30 seconds.

Nonetheless, the authors maintained that mouthwashes should not appropriate for treating Covid-19 however might scale back the viral load within the brief time period the place the best potential for an infection comes from.

“Whether or not this impact is confirmed in medical observe and the way lengthy it lasts should be investigated in additional research,” the research authors wrote.
